Industrial Applications of Diethanolamine

Diethanolamine (CAS 111-42-2) serves as a critical raw material in multiple industrial processes beyond metalworking fluids, including the production of surfactants, emulsifiers, and corrosion inhibitors. In metal processing applications specifically, it functions as an effective pH adjuster and lubricity enhancer, improving cutting fluid performance and extending tool life in various machining operations. Its chemical properties make it particularly valuable in formulating water-based metalworking fluids where stability and material compatibility are paramount.

Storage & Handling

  • Store in a cool, dry, well-ventilated area, sealed and away from direct sunlight.
  • Keep away from incompatible materials, food and feed sources.
  • Handle with appropriate personal protective equipment (gloves, goggles, lab coat).
  • Follow good industrial hygiene practices. Avoid inhalation and skin contact.
  • Refer to MSDS for detailed storage and safety instructions.
